Recent technological advances have opened new exciting possibilities for the development of cutting-edge quantum devices, including quantum random access memory (QRAM) systems. These are memory architectures specifically meant to be integrated inside quantum computers, which can simultaneously retrieve data from multiple ‘locations’ leveraging a quantum effect known as coherent superposition.Quantum Physics NewsRead More
